Michael Mastro Cleveland, Ohio

Michael grew up around influences of classic rock, pop and jazz. Early on he was exposed to a variety of musical styles from Grand Funk, Parliament Funkadelic, Jimi Hendrix, Sinatra, Steve Earle and everything in-between.
